Shiny Mesprit

The shiny version of Mesprit in Pokémon GO was released on 14-09-2021.
Mesprit was originally discovered in the Sinnoh region. The main colors of shiny Mesprit are gold, and red. The typing of this Pokémon is psychic. The Pokédex number of Mesprit is #481. In the dex they call Mesprit the Emotion Pokémon

It sleeps at the bottom of a lake. Its spirit is said to leave its body to fly on the lake's surface. This Pokémon is a legendary Pokémon, thereby it is not available in the wild. It can only be caught by raids, during events or by completing tasks.

Mesprit belongs to the Mesprit family.
